How Common Is The Last Name Eberdt?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 1,828,462nd most frequent family name throughout the world, held by around 1 in 71,446,529 people. The surname Eberdt is mostly found in The Americas, where 78 percent of Eberdt live; 73 percent live in North America and 73 percent live in Anglo-North America.
This surname is most frequently used in The United States, where it is borne by 67 people, or 1 in 5,409,835. In The United States it is most frequent in: North Carolina, where 27 percent reside, Wisconsin, where 15 percent reside and Oregon, where 13 percent reside. Besides The United States this surname exists in 6 countries. It is also common in Germany, where 18 percent reside and Canada, where 7 percent reside.
Eberdt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The frequency of Eberdt has changed over time. In The United States the number of people who held the Eberdt surname rose 558 percent between 1880 and 2014.
